how to delet a messenger conversation at other end
You can’t delete a Messenger conversation from the other person’s phone. Deleting a chat only removes it from your side, while “unsend” can remove your own message for everyone if it’s still available.
What you can do
- Delete the conversation: removes it only from your inbox. The other person still keeps it.
- Unsend a message you sent: removes that specific message from both sides.
- You cannot remove messages the other person sent from their chat.
Steps for one message
- Open the chat.
- Long-press your message.
- Tap Delete or Remove.
- Choose Unsend or Delete for everyone if that option appears.
Important note
If the message was sent a while ago, the unsend option may no longer be available.
Plain answer
If your goal is to erase the whole conversation on the other end, Messenger does not let you do that. The closest option is unsending your own messages one by one, when allowed.
